Total Visas | % of all Visas | Average Wage | Visa Type |
---|---|---|---|
304,622 | 85.94% | $103,635 | H-1B |
41,076 | 11.59% | $149,496 | PERM |
6,032 | 1.70% | $110,940 | E-3 Australian |
2,735 | 0.77% | $32,429 | H-2A |
As of May 2023, Washington has seen a total of 354,465 visa workers across all visa types. The most common visa class in Washington is the H-1B visa with 304,622 H-1B visas on record over all years accounting for 85.94% of Washington's total visas. The second most prevalent visa is the PERM visa with 41,076 PERM visas on record over all years accounting for 11.59% of Washington's total visas.
